Mesothelioma lawsuits are part of personal injury litigation and mesothelioma legal essentially are designed to prove negligence on the part of the defendant accountable for the victim's asbestos exposure. A mesothelioma suit could include a wrongful death claim which seeks to compensate a loved ones of the deceased victim's family.

Asbestos-related companies have had to deal with massive asbestos lawsuits in recent years and have often sought bankruptcy protection. This permits companies to reorganize and set up asbestos trust funds to pay victims without recourse to the courts. The most effective mesothelioma lawyers will determine if a victim is eligible for an asbestos trust fund or lawsuit filed against a company that has gone out of business. They can also assist veterans understand what benefits or compensation types they may be entitled to based on their military service and mesothelioma diagnosis. They can even assist patients present their cases to the appropriate military tribunal should they need to.

Jury Verdicts

The majority of mesothelioma cases are settled outside of court. However, if the defendants do not agree to an agreement, and the plaintiff is not satisfied, the case will go to trial. At the trial, plaintiffs and mesothelioma legal their lawyers present evidence to a judge and jury. The judges and jury will decide whether the victim is entitled to compensation.

Mesothelioma patients are eligible for punitive and compensatory damages. Compensation damages are intended to compensate for the financial loss resulting from lost wages, medical expenses and funeral expenses. Punitive damages can be given to the victims in order to punish the company and deter future asbestos-related mishaps.
